javascript - Angular 2/4 接口(interface)声明问题

标签 javascript angular typescript

我发现在 Angular 中,我们必须在处理来自服务器的 JSON 数据之前声明一个接口(interface)。 小型 json 结构没问题,但假设我们有一个包含一百个键值对的大型 json 文件,我认为在我们的应用程序中创建精确的界面很困难。

这个问题有什么解决办法吗?

最佳答案

您不必创建接口(interface)。您想要创建一个界面,以便可以享受强类型语言(typescript)的好处。

您可以只使用“any”,但您仍然必须记住“json”的元素才能访问其值。

关于javascript - Angular 2/4 接口(interface)声明问题,我们在Stack Overflow上找到一个类似的问题: https://stackoverflow.com/questions/46728330/

相关文章:

javascript - 从 VS Code 中的 JS 文件中删除 [ts] 错误

angular - SignalRCore - 无法获取更新的数据。 - 使用定时器管理器

node.js - 从 JSON 模块加载 Nest.js 应用程序的端口号

JavaScript 搜索功能

javascript - 如何同时处理 promise 和 non-promise 错误捕获

angular - 如何使用 HostListener

javascript - JS : Counting Elements in Array -> Returning Array of Arrays

typescript - 如何使用对象定义类字段构建 TypeScript 类构造函数?

javascript - 使用 Javascript/JQuery 检索 JSON GET 数据

javascript - 当值为对象时,在 md-select 上设置默认值 Angular4 Angular-Material